Shift, I suggest you go to https://www.kvr-vst.com and take a look at their forums, especially the ‘Hosts’ forum.

Vst’s are software effects or software instruments, many of them of extremely high quality, some of those even being freeware. To be able to host those you should have a program like FL Studio, Tracktion, Orion, Cubase or whatever suits your needs.
I personally don’t use Tracktion, but I have only heard very good things about it. Also, I think, there is a free sequencer/host called ‘Muzys’ or something to that effect that comes free with a magazine called ‘Computer Music’ or something like that. Again, I have not used that, either, but it should be a great starting point for you.

Believe me: Most of the software mentioned above, is REALLY easy to use, plus the support for Tracktion is awesome, the creator has his own Tracktion forum at KvR and the people there will be more than willing to help you.
